Malayahedi

Malayahedi is a village located in Moman Badodiya tehsil of Shajapur district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Moman Badodiya (tehsildar office) and 51km away from district headquarter Shajapur. As per 2009 stats, Malyahedi is the gram panchayat of Malayahedi village.

About Malayahedi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Malayahedi is 472892. The village spans a total geographical area of 421.5 hectares. Moman Badodiya is nearest town to Malayahedi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

When it comes to local governance, Malayahedi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Susner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Rajgarh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Malayahedi

Below is a concise population overview of Malayahedi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,219 645 574
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 163 90 73
Scheduled Castes (SC) 131 62 69
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 608 333 275
Literate Population 718 453 265
Illiterate Population 501 192 309

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Malayahedi village:

  • The total population of Malayahedi village is around 1,219, including approximately 645 males and 574 females, with a sex ratio of 889 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 163 children aged 0–6 years in Malayahedi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Malayahedi village has 131 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 608 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Malayahedi village is about 58.90%, with male literacy at 70.23% and female literacy at 46.17%.
  • There are around 242 households in Malayahedi village.

Connectivity of Malayahedi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Malayahedi. As per the 2011 stats, Malayahedi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
